Q: Is 71,575,410 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 71,575,410 is not a prime number.

Why is 71,575,410 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 71575410 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 5 6 10 15 30 2,385,847 4,771,694 7,157,541 11,929,235 14,315,082 23,858,470 35,787,705 and 71,575,410, with no remainder.

Since 71,575,410 cannot be divided by just 1 and 71,575,410, it is not a prime number.
